What causes fence posts to shift or lean in San Diego, and how can Pool Guard USA fix it?

San Diego’s clay-heavy soil expands and contracts with seasonal moisture, which can cause fence posts to loosen and lean over time. Pool Guard USA stabilizes posts by using deep-set concrete footings and post anchors designed for local soil conditions. For existing posts, they can reset them with proper drainage gravel to prevent future movement.

How does Pool Guard USA prevent chain link fence corrosion near the coast in San Diego?

Salt air from the Pacific Ocean accelerates rust on standard chain link fencing. Pool Guard USA offers galvanized and vinyl-coated chain link options that resist corrosion. They also apply protective coatings and use stainless steel fittings to ensure your fence stays strong and rust-free, even in coastal neighborhoods like Mission Beach or Point Loma.

What are signs my fence needs professional repair or replacement from Pool Guard USA?

Common signs include leaning or loose posts, rust spots on chain link, sagging gates, and gaps at the bottom of the fence. If posts wobble when pushed or if the chain link has visible corrosion, it’s time to call Pool Guard USA. They’ll inspect your fence and recommend either targeted repairs or a replacement using materials suited to San Diego’s climate.
